Not really.
AlphaGo背后使用的是在最近几年得到长足发展的神经网络算法(现在也叫深度学习)。这种算法简单来说是通过模拟大脑神经元的运行模式而实现的,所以在某种程度上非常像人类的思维方式,而不是像曾经的深蓝那样纯粹靠预设规则和暴力计算取胜。
关于AlphaGo的算法网上有太多文章,我简单科普一下几个要点:
AlphaGo有两个基本算法,一个是用来判断局面优劣的,好比棋手的大局观。另一个是用来计算后续变化的,好比棋手的计算能力。前一个算法提供几个较优的落子选择,后一个对每一个选择进行后续的推演,通过比较结果得到最优选择。
另一个方面是Reinforce Learning(强化学习)能力,这是DeepMind创始人Demis Hassabis的强项。(这家伙绝对是科技界继盖茨,乔布斯,马斯克之后的又一个传奇,计算机和脑神经双修,两个领域都有Nature Paper发表,跪了。。。)简单来说就是自己学习。这次比赛前AlphaGo据说和自己下了数万盘对局,这种强度是人类绝对无法比拟的。
Again,AlphaGo的胜利不是简单的硬件和计算能力的堆砌。
只是提升计算机的运算能力罢。以前说围棋比国际象棋难道大,是因为棋盘大,可以走的变化多。电脑的学习过程就是尽量多的学习棋谱和套路。就好比学习了所有的可能出现的对局后,每下一步都是在对方余下可以出的所有可能中找出对自己最有利的一步。如果比较记忆和高速运算能力,人脑最终肯定要败给电脑的。电脑只不过是在重复人类已知的东西,人脑的优势在于创造力,这点目前电脑做不到。从来都是人类提出假设,电脑去验证。你们什么时候见过电脑能发明新的东西。这次人机大战,不过是背后的工程师团队编写的逻辑运算能力比以前大大提高吧了。说是人机对战,还不如说是一群工程师加一个超级计算机对一个专业棋手罢了。